Output 5a10b4fde21ebe23343d179d19b5b217536cc974742279205bf235847029360b:63

value
521000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88aee6905886f50f246b94ea61a9131eaa475404 OP_EQUALVERIFY OP_CHECKSIG
address
1DTiRQ7PfqqjBtSmq9XojwfCDftqdx5JoA
transaction
5a10b4fde21ebe23343d179d19b5b217536cc974742279205bf235847029360b
confirmations
196811
spent
true